Dedicated and professional with a fantastic sense of humour, Gabby Logan is one of the UK’s premier broadcasters and presenters. She is in great demand both on television and on the corporate circuit, presenting and hosting awards shows and events.
Gabby presents Final Score, Inside Sport, the Six Nations and the Autumn Rugby Internationals for BBC One. She is a key member of the BBC presentation team and presents for Match of the Day as well as the One Show. Gabby was also in South Africa reporting on the England team for the 2010 World Cup.
A former international gymnast, Gabby began her broadcasting career in radio in 1992 and joined Sky Sports in 1996, where she quickly established herself as a football presenter. First joining ITV in 1998 to front On The Ball during her nine years at the channel Gabby’s repertoire expanded and her presenting credits include the World Cup, Champion's League and the Premiership as well as the Boat Race and sports news reporting. In 2004 she co-hosted Sport Relief with Gary Lineker for the BBC, before joining the corporation in 2007.
Following various stints on the station, Gabby began presenting a regular weekly Sunday morning show on BBC in February 2008. From January 2010 she has presented a weekday 12pm – 2pm show, covering news and sport from across the UK as well as comprehensive analysis of Prime Minister's Questions every Wednesday.
She is a columnist for The Times and has previously written for the Sunday Mirror, The Independent and Yorkshire Post.
Currently a patron of the Disabilities Trust, Prince’s Trust and Great Ormond Street, Gabby is also a vice president of Sparks. She lives in London with her husband and two children.
